Abstract

The invention is directed to a pod clamping unit for fixing a pod to a support table in a load port, the pod including a pod body capable of storing a wafer in the interior thereof and a lid, the load port having a pod opener that opens/closes the lid. The pod clamping unit includes a clamp portion that is provided on the support table and adapted to engage with a first engagement portion provided on a lower surface of the pod body to restrict upward movement of the pod relative to the support table, a restriction pin that is movable upwardly and downwardly relative to the support table and adapted to engage with a second engagement portion provided on the lower surface of the pod body to restrict movement of the pod in a disengaging direction that causes disengagement between the first engagement portion and the clamp portion, and a vertically driving portion that moves the restriction pin up to/down from the second engagement portion.
